Atomera Incorporated (ATOM) closed at $9.24, up 8.58% on the session, as renewed buying interest propelled the stock above its near-term resistance area. The move currently holds above the support level of $8.78, while resistance stands at $9.7. Momentum appears to be building following a period of consolidation.

Volume during the session was significantly above the 50-day average, suggesting institutional participation and conviction behind the move. Atomera, a semiconductor materials company focused on its Mears Silicon Technology (MST), operates in a sector that has recently seen heightened investor interest on optimism around AI chips and advanced node manufacturing. While specific company news was absent during the session, the broader semiconductor foundry and materials sub-industries have been attracting capital as the industry cycles through an inventory correction toward a potential upturn. The advance from $8.78 support to the current $9.24 represents an 8.6% gain, indicating that short-term traders may be positioning ahead of either a breakout above the $9.7 resistance or a potential catalyst such as a partnership update or licensing agreement. The price action suggests that traders are paying attention to the stock’s ability to hold above the $9.00 psychological level, which acted as resistance intraday during the prior week. Small-cap semiconductor names like Atomera often experience outsized moves on relatively light float, and today’s activity fits that pattern with increased turnover. From a technical perspective, ATOM has broken above its 20-day exponential moving average (EMA), which currently lies in the high $8.80s, and is testing the 50-day simple moving average near the $9.20s. The Relative Strength Index (RSI) has moved into the mid-60s, suggesting bullish momentum without yet reaching overbought territory (typically above 70). The 14-day RSI reading indicates that further upside potential may exist before overextension. The stock has formed a series of higher lows since late June, with the $8.78 support level providing a reliable floor. The next meaningful resistance is at the $9.7 mark, which coincides with the 100-day moving average around the same area. A close above $9.7 would likely signal a breakout from the short-term trading range that has persisted since mid-June. On the downside, initial support now stands at the breakout level near $9.10, followed by the $8.78 level. The bullish candlestick body on the daily chart closed near the session high, indicating buying pressure persisted through the close. Volume analysis suggests accumulation is taking place. Going forward, ATOM’s price trajectory may be influenced by several factors. A sustained move above the $9.7 resistance could open the door to a test of the $10.50 to $11.00 zone, where the stock traded in May. However, failure to break through $9.7 on increased volume might result in a pullback toward the $9.10 support or a retest of $8.78. Fundamental catalysts such as new licensing agreements or updates on MST adoption by foundries could provide additional momentum. Conversely, a broader market downturn or negative sector sentiment could weigh on the stock. Traders may watch for volume confirmation on any breakout attempt—a move above $9.7 on above-average volume would be a constructive signal. The stock’s beta suggests higher volatility compared to the market, so position sizing may require consideration. For now, the uptrend appears intact as long as the price holds above the rising 20-day EMA. A break below $8.78 could negate the bullish pattern and lead to a retest of the $8.00 area. The next few sessions will be key in determining whether this rally has staying power or is merely a short-term reactive move.
